Downloading CSV files

For some reason my CSV files which used to download to moneydance now go to Microsoft EXcel. How do I get them to download to moneydance again?

    When you install Moneydance, you're asked to specify if Moneydance is to be used as the default for a number of different file formats - one of these formats is CSV. Perhaps this setting was inadvertently selected during the setup process?

    I believe you're using Windows 10, so you can fix this within your OS settings.

    You should 'right click' (or press Ctrl and click) on the CSV file to view the menu.
    Choose 'Open With' and select 'Choose Another App'.
    In the window that opens, select the program you prefer to use.
    Make sure you enable the box 'Always use this app to open these files'.

    If this doesn't work, you can follow the steps below to set another program as the default program to open CSV files -

    • Open the Start menu and begin typing 'Settings'.
    • This will reveal the Settings app which you should select to open it.
    • Choose 'Apps' from within the Settings window.
    • Then choose 'Default Apps' from the list on the left.
    • Then scroll down and select 'Choose default apps by file'.
    • Then scroll down again until you see '.CSV' displayed within the list on the left.
    • To the right of this, you should see the default program used - select this to change it.
